summaryrefslogtreecommitdiffstats
path: root/llvm/lib/CodeGen/RegUsageInfoCollector.cpp
diff options
context:
space:
mode:
authorMatt Arsenault <Matthew.Arsenault@amd.com>2019-07-11 14:41:40 +0000
committerMatt Arsenault <Matthew.Arsenault@amd.com>2019-07-11 14:41:40 +0000
commit6eb8ae8f17b4f4ae2523dba3207ef9e2aadc2ad6 (patch)
treed16e0a3b9142d03d1517683d58b44dbe8a6e0edb /llvm/lib/CodeGen/RegUsageInfoCollector.cpp
parentb725d27350ffdda9e8e9144668ad54c922297f59 (diff)
downloadbcm5719-llvm-6eb8ae8f17b4f4ae2523dba3207ef9e2aadc2ad6.tar.gz
bcm5719-llvm-6eb8ae8f17b4f4ae2523dba3207ef9e2aadc2ad6.zip
RegUsageInfoCollector: Skip calling conventions I missed before
llvm-svn: 365784
Diffstat (limited to 'llvm/lib/CodeGen/RegUsageInfoCollector.cpp')
-rw-r--r--llvm/lib/CodeGen/RegUsageInfoCollector.cpp3
1 files changed, 3 insertions, 0 deletions
diff --git a/llvm/lib/CodeGen/RegUsageInfoCollector.cpp b/llvm/lib/CodeGen/RegUsageInfoCollector.cpp
index ee1662a252c..b37dfada710 100644
--- a/llvm/lib/CodeGen/RegUsageInfoCollector.cpp
+++ b/llvm/lib/CodeGen/RegUsageInfoCollector.cpp
@@ -88,6 +88,9 @@ static bool isCallableFunction(const MachineFunction &MF) {
case CallingConv::AMDGPU_GS:
case CallingConv::AMDGPU_PS:
case CallingConv::AMDGPU_CS:
+ case CallingConv::AMDGPU_HS:
+ case CallingConv::AMDGPU_ES:
+ case CallingConv::AMDGPU_LS:
case CallingConv::AMDGPU_KERNEL:
return false;
default:
OpenPOWER on IntegriCloud